HELLO! Hall Of Fame Awards, which is a decade-old initiative of the RP-Sanjiv Goenka Group, is all set to host its first ever South Edition on January 24 at Taj Krishna, in Hyderabad. The awards night will be dedicated to the most glamorous movie stars, eminent business icons, stellar sports personalities, doyens of art and culture, regal royalty and fashionistas over champagne-laden celebrations all under one roof.

The theme for the evening is ‘A Night at the Opera’ which will add an element of mystique and grandeur to the occasion, with all things red, gold and ornate. Building on the 10 years of success of HELLO! Hall of Fame, the South edition will be one big star-studded affair, hosted by singer, and actress Sophie Choudry.

Ananya Panday’s masterclass in rocking sheer outfits

Sheer has taken over our collective fashion conscience, cropping up everywhere from the closets of street style stars to showbiz veterans. Once relegated to sexy negligees, this risqué trend has made its way out of the bedroom and found itself in the party section of everyone’s wardrobe as well as the workwear section the next morning. Wondering how to work the trend without risking any OTT moments? Take notes from the best aka Ananya Panday. The Gehraiyaan actress was the perfect mix of edgy and chic in an asymmetrical lace Aadnevik gown.

Kartik Aaryan showing us how to do ‘casual chic’ right

The actor chose to pair his trademark hairdo and smile with a navy blue Dior suit, layered over a white turtleneck and comfy sneakers. Serving lessons in dressing down a formal suit, you’d much rather believe the actor is a pro at not letting a structured piece such as a suit not overshadow his cool guy vibe.

Dramatic Entrance 101, featuring Kriti Sanon

The Mimi actress brought the drama to the red carpet in her lilac Atelier Zuhair gown with a long ruffled train following behind her. Sanon teaches us how to choose a silhouette that knows how to flatter your body right without sacrificing the theatrics.

Masaba Gupta on power dressing in 2023

The designer looked all things fierce in her custom-made corset and skirt paired with statement jewellery from the House of Masaba. If you want to elevate a basic black outfit to a red-carpet ready ensemble, a corset top to cinch in that waist in and unique gold jewellery is all you need.

How to match your hair to your outfit, thanks to Kiara Advani

Kiara Advani looked like an especially bright ray of sunshine in a sleek, yellow sequinned dress by Dhruv Kapoor. But what made her stand out even more was her long, sleek rope braid. “(Kiara) wanted to try something different than usual and so we decided to go with a futuristic look to match her sleek outfit,” shared Nishi Singh, Advani’s hair stylist for the look.
